๐ SYNOPSIS
"Orushipe Suopu," meaning "storytelling of this place" in the Ainu language, is a collection of short animated films produced annually since 2012. These films, a collaboration between the Foundation for Research and Promotion of Ainu Culture (FRPAC) and various directors from Studio Rocca, are set within the Ainu land and culture, specifically in the region of Hokkaido, formerly known as Ezochi. The films are designed to be shown at museums, schools, and film festivals, including "The New Chitose Airport International Animation Festival," which is celebrating Hokkaido's 150th anniversary. The films are available on the official YouTube channel with various audio and subtitle options, released roughly a year after their initial showcase, and are also available on DVD. The series focuses on sharing Ainu stories.
